Data Report: How the City responded to homelessness Aug. 25-31

The City of Sacramento has released its weekly progress report for the City’s Incident Management Team (IMT) responding to homelessness.

From Aug. 25,-31 the City of Sacramento received 657 calls to 311 customer service related to unsheltered individuals.

These calls resulted in 1,864 “cases” being opened, a new data category the City began including on July 28, 2025. The addition of this category reflects the City’s efforts to better inform the public of its ongoing work to address the homelessness crisis as well as upgrades made to the 311 reporting system…
